diff --git a/scripts/codeconverter/codeconverter/utils.py b/scripts/codeconverter/codeconverter/utils.py new file mode 100644 index 000000000..760ab7eec --- /dev/null +++ b/scripts/codeconverter/codeconverter/utils.py @@ -0,0 +1,72 @@ +# Copyright (C) 2020 Red Hat Inc. +# +# Authors: +# Eduardo Habkost <ehabkost@redhat.com> +# +# This work is licensed under the terms of the GNU GPL, version 2. See +# the COPYING file in the top-level directory. +from typing import * + +import logging +logger = logging.getLogger(__name__) +DBG = logger.debug +INFO = logger.info +WARN = logger.warning + +T = TypeVar('T') +def opt_compare(a: T, b: T) -> bool: + """Compare two values, ignoring mismatches if one of them is None""" + return (a is None) or (b is None) or (a == b) + +def merge(a: T, b: T) -> T: + """Merge two values if they matched using opt_compare()""" + assert opt_compare(a, b) + if a is None: + return b + else: + return a + +def test_comp_merge(): + assert opt_compare(None, 1) == True + assert opt_compare(2, None) == True + assert opt_compare(1, 1) == True + assert opt_compare(1, 2) == False + + assert merge(None, None) is None + assert merge(None, 10) == 10 + assert merge(10, None) == 10 + assert merge(10, 10) == 10 + + +LineNumber = NewType('LineNumber', int) +ColumnNumber = NewType('ColumnNumber', int) +class LineAndColumn(NamedTuple): + line: int + col: int + + def __str__(self): + return '%d:%d' % (self.line, self.col) + +def line_col(s, position: int) -> LineAndColumn: + """Return line and column for a char position in string + + Character position starts in 0, but lines and columns start in 1. + """ + before = s[:position] + lines = before.split('\n') + line = len(lines) + col = len(lines[-1]) + 1 + return LineAndColumn(line, col) + +def test_line_col(): + assert line_col('abc\ndefg\nhijkl', 0) == (1, 1) + assert line_col('abc\ndefg\nhijkl', 2) == (1, 3) + assert line_col('abc\ndefg\nhijkl', 3) == (1, 4) + assert line_col('abc\ndefg\nhijkl', 4) == (2, 1) + assert line_col('abc\ndefg\nhijkl', 10) == (3, 2) + +def not_optional(arg: Optional[T]) -> T: + assert arg is not None + return arg + +__all__ = ['not_optional', 'opt_compare', 'merge', 'line_col', 'LineAndColumn']
